Frequently Asked Questions on Camera Transport

How to transport a DSLR camera?

It is important that we transport our photographic equipment in a bag or backpack specifically for photography. This will allow us to keep the material tight and padded to avoid bumps and scratches during transport. How to carry photographic equipment on a plane?

When taking photographic equipment on a plane we must take into account several factors such as the weight allowed by our airline and the capacity in Wh of the batteries we are going to transport, in practice, most batteries for photographic use are within the allowed values.

It is compulsory to transport batteries as hand luggage so you should prepare your luggage with this in mind. You should also protect all your luggage thoroughly, especially checked luggage, by using suitable transport equipment such as trolleys or suitcases.
